Great Stuff that Martin - thanks for posting it -a very interesting 20 minutes or so - and only been in youtube a few days.

Our ex Club 12 Hour record holder was starring - Ken has done a lot of work up there over many years to keep that piece of history still going

You have made me think that it is time I went and enjoyed another chunk of nostalgia!

It is only open Sunday as far as I know and at the last check those pots of Tea would set you back all of 50 pence!
